What is environmental impact assessment?

An environmental impact assessment (EIA) is a pre-approval review that predicts a proposed project’s likely environmental impacts and mitigation measures. It evaluates effects on air, water, soil, wildlife, and nearby communities to reduce harm before construction begins. This article explains what an EIA is, what it covers, and how the process works.
